Case Study: Avasta
(Adobe Acrobat (.pdf) version
612k PDF)
Leading Application Management Firm, Avasta, Integrates
Reactor 5 Workflow Engine in 30 Days
The Challenge
As one of the leading providers of enterprise application management,
Avasta offers more than just simple system monitoring, but rather, total
technology-enabled process support for 24/7, mission critical enterprise
solutions. Avasta’s ability to automatically sense, diagnose and repair
application issues clearly differentiates them from other application
support organizations. As such, they knew that a robust workflow solution
could help them bring even greater efficiencies to their clients’ operations
– as well as, of course - to their own.
The question was whether they could find that solution. Although Avasta
was aware of the many workflow options on the market, they realized their
perfect solution would not only have to address every item in their long
list of needs – but be deployable almost immediately, so as to allow them
to get to market quickly and maintain their competitive edge.
Third Party Vendor Options
Avasta began by evaluating a wide range of workflow software options.
The firm quickly determined, however, that none of these was sufficient
to meet their unique needs. Although this evaluation included some of
the most well-known and popular products on the market, all were eventually
rejected for one or more of the follow reasons:
- Too expensive
- Overly loaded with unnecessary functionality
- Limited to working on a single, inflexible platform
- Poorly designed
- Insufficiently focused on the business process
Internal Development Options
Unable to find a third-party product to their liking, Avasta briefly considered
building a solution in-house. After analyzing the project, however, they
concluded it would take more than six months to develop an initial version
that would have only barely met their most basic needs.
Unfortunately, this meant Avasta was still without a solution that was
up to their standards. That’s when they learned about Reactor 5 from Oak
Grove Systems.
The Reactor 5 Solution
After a thorough analysis of Reactor’s capabilities, Avasta determined
that the product fit its needs better than any other on the market. In
particular, Avasta was impressed with Reactor’s:
o Elegant, low-impact architecture
o Pure Java technology
o Flexible “stateless session beans”
o XML-based messaging
o Flexible and extensible Reactor Studio process design module
o Scripting support using Bean scripting framework
The ability to license the Reactor source code was also very attractive
to Avasta. ”Although we almost certainly would have bought a commercial
version of Reactor 5,” reports Vince Sheffer, chief architect of Avasta,
“Its availability as source code put it over the top. Having the source
code gives us complete knowledge, confidence and control.”
The Final Results
As it addressed one of its primary concerns, Avasta was delighted by Reactor’s
ease – and speed - of integration. In fact, the firm was able to both
learn the software and integrate it completely into a number of its most
important applications in less than 30 days – a far cry from the more
than six months it would have taken to develop a substantially less acceptable
version in-house.
Indeed, Reactor already serves as the critical component in the core technology
orchestrating Avasta AutoAssist technology, which automates the repair
of repetitive failure patterns and other known application bugs.
Reactor’s flexibility will also allow Avasta to develop a series of generic
and custom products they plan to sell to clients in the future. In the
future, these applications will allow business processes to be dynamically
adjusted to fit individual client needs. This type of custom client level
automation control would simply not have been possible before Avasta’s
implementation of Reactor 5.
“After evaluating over 15 different workflow engines, Reactor 5 was our
clear choice to embed into Avasta’s groundbreaking Application Management
Suite,” said Scott Hanham, Avasta, CTO & Vice President of Engineering,
“in fact, we plan on embedding Reactor 5 into future applications as well.”
Providing the functionality they desired, and the speed to market they
had to have, Reactor 5 turned out to be exactly what Avasta was looking
for – the perfect workflow fit.
